Visa Subclass Options

There are several visa subclasses available for students wishing to study in Australia. The most common subclass is the Subclass 500 visa, which is designed for full-time students enrolled in a registered course. To be eligible for this visa, you must have been accepted into a registered course, have health insurance, and meet English language proficiency requirements.

Financial Requirements

One of the key requirements for obtaining a student visa is demonstrating that you have enough funds to cover your tuition fees, living expenses, and any accompanying family members. The Department of Home Affairs sets the minimum financial requirements, and it is important to provide evidence of your ability to meet these requirements.

Work Rights

Student visa holders in Australia are generally permitted to work up to 40 hours per fortnight while their course is in session, and unlimited hours during scheduled course breaks. This is a valuable opportunity for international students to gain work experience and supplement their income during their studies.
